中等
技术面试0 次浏览在蚂蚁集团的电商支付场景中,设计一个简单的订单支付流程,要求考虑并发处理和数据一致性。
蚂蚁集团后端工程师
电商支付并发处理数据一致性
答题要点
推荐答题框架:使用 STAR 法则,先描述场景(S),再说明任务(T),接着阐述行动(A),最后说明结果(R)。关键要点如下:1. 场景分析:明确电商支付场景的特点,如高并发、数据准确性要求高。2. 任务定义:确定订单支付流程的主要步骤,如订单创建、支付验证等。3. 并发处理:采用锁机制或分布式事务等方法处理并发请求。4. 数据一致性:通过事务处理保证支付数据的一致性。示例话术:在电商支付场景中,首先创建订单,然后用户发起支付请求。为了处理并发,我们可以使用分布式锁来控制对订单数据的访问。在支付验证环节,使用事务确保数据的一致性。通过这样的设计,能有效应对高并发情况,保证支付流程的准确和稳定。